Lesson 7: Be selective in your advertising.

When you are starting out it can be tempting to go all out with newspaper ads, mail outs, cold calling, flyers, yellow pages (print or online) – but not all these tools work. You need to find out what works for your area – and for your target market. Speak to other business owners in your area to see what has worked locally.

Try a couple, keep track of where your leads are coming from and stick with what works.

As tempting as it is, if you use every method known to man you will soon overcapitalise, spending more than the revenue it brings in.

Consider ROI carefully!
